## Environment Variables — GridWeaver Crossword Generator

Welcome, future maintainer! GridWeaver reads everything from `.env` at startup, no exceptions. `GRID_MAX_SIZE` caps puzzle dimensions (keep it under 25 unless you enjoy timeouts), `WORDLIST_PATH` points at the curated Tansley lexicon, and `CLUE_STYLE` toggles cryptic mode. Most values are boring and safe to commit. The one exception is the clue-suggestion API credential, which must never land in the repo. Add it on the next line.

sealed setting: ARCHIVE_KEY3=8d0

### Calendar sync conflicts (Meridel Scheduler)

When two clients write overlapping event edits, the Meridel sync worker quarantines both revisions and pages on-call. First, check the conflict queue in the admin panel and confirm timestamps — clock skew on the Harrowgate nodes is the usual culprit. Resolve by replaying the newer revision with `medsync replay`. The replay bundle must be signed or the worker discards it silently. Sign it with the key below.

rollout seal: bky4_x7Gc

Subject: DR drill Friday — Quillbridge circuit breaker

Plugin authors: Friday we trip the Quillbridge breaker against the upstream Harrowlane API. Expect 503s for ten minutes. Plugins must back off, not hammer retries. Half-open probes resume automatically. Log breaker events; we'll audit. To access the drill sandbox, authenticate with the passphrase below.

unlock words, fadug-tageg: zorix-wenwyn-quenmir

Step 4: Ship the WaveGlint preview bundle. Quick context for review: the audio waveform preview renders client-side from downsampled peaks, so no raw audio leaves the Tonelark CDN edge. The bundle itself is static JS plus a worker, built reproducibly from the locked manifest. Before it goes out, we sign the tarball so the edge nodes refuse anything unsigned. The signing key the pipeline uses is shown below.

deploy key for kajof-yawif: bky9_fvxrpdHPq

### Door Sensor Recall — Please Read

The Vexley-9 door sensors on floors 2 and 3 are being recalled and may fail to read badges. Don't tailgate; use the stairwell doors on the north side instead. Replacement units arrive next week. Until then, affected doors accept manual entry with the code below.

door code, yagap-bahof: bdg-O-05